WIC Association of New York State The WIC Association of NYS is a voluntary, nonprofit organization dedicated to meeting the nutritional needs of the WIC eligible community.

Thank you, Assemblymember Jessica González-Rojas, for your tireless leadership for women’s issues of all kinds and your advocacy for WIC on yesterday’s The Capitol Pressroom interview! We are sure the 460k participating NYers and the 85 local WIC programs' workforce of nutrition professionals, lactation experts, and peer counselors operating in hospitals, community health centers, county departments of health, and community-based organizations thank you, too!

You’re absolutely right; with $540M federal food dollars now coming back to local NYS communities through WIC prescribed foods, NYS needs a $30M additional state investment in WIC infrastructure to brace the successful modernizations and outreach in recent years resulting in 100k more New Yorkers now participating in WIC’s long-proven public health nutrition services! And of course we want to reach more of the 200k more who could participate!

WIC Voices Needed Now

Amid rising food insecurity and unprecedented federal cuts to SNAP, state action is needed NOW to protect New York families’ access to WIC. As state leaders negotiate details of the final budget, elevate the urgency of state investment in these vital programs.

Message:
Protect access to WIC. Participation in WIC in New York has increased over 25 percent since 2020, now serving ~460,000 New Yorkers, while WIC local agencies have remained nearly flat-funded for the past decade. Additional $30M in state funding will help stabilize services at local agencies and ensure timely access to WIC's modernized essential health and nutrition services.

Featured Session: Food Allergy Awareness for WIC Staff: Unpacking the New Food Packages

Presented By: Susan Krahn, MS, RDN, CD, CLC

Nearly 11% of adults and 8% of children have at least one food allergy. WIC staff play an important role in supporting participants with food allergies by providing education and tailored food packages. Join Susan Krahn, MS, RDN, CD, CLC, an author with Nutrition Matters, experienced WIC dietitian and mom of a child with food allergies, as she shares practical and research-based information WIC staff can use to refresh their knowledge on common food allergies and intolerances.

Join this session to learn about:

🥜 the most common food allergies and intolerances, as well as the most common food allergens in WIC-approved foods

🥛 ways to tailor food packages with the new food options

🥚 important food allergy messages into WIC nutrition education
